Edward Hemsted (10 October 1846 – 12 March 1884) was an English cricketer. Hemsted was a right-handed batsman who bowled right-arm roundarm fast.Hemsted made his first-class debut for the Gentlemen of Kent against the Gentlemen of Marylebone Cricket Club in 1863.Hemsted made his Hampshire debut 1866, against the Marylebone Cricket Club. During the 1866 season, Hemsted claimed his maiden and only five wicket haul against Surrey, taking figures of 5/14.
